LYRICIST-LIBRETTIST: Member of Lehman Engel's BMI Musical Theater Workshop from 1975 until Mr. Engel's death in 1982, and with Bill Grossman, Skip Kennon and Bob Trien wrote songs that were performed in three of the workshop's showcases. At Juilliard wrote additional lyrics for the 1985 production of THE BEGGAR'S OPERA (music arranged by Stanley Silverman and Edward Flower). Wrote lyrics for Raphael Crystal’s music for MUCH ADO ABOUT NOTHING, THE WINTER'S TALE and LOVE'S LABOR'S LOST, produced by Cressid at Lincoln Center and elsewhere, as well as for LOVE ME, LOVE ME NOT.

TRANSLATIONS: THE
THREE SISTERS, UNCLE VANYA and LIOLA. Translated into English all the dialogue from the Opéra-Comique version of CARMEN; see Sample. Made singing translations of arias from DIE MEISTERSINGER, DIE ENTFÜHRUNG, DON GIOVANNI, and IL BARBIERE and several Schubert songs; "The Elfking" was performed at Symphony Space's Wall-To-Wall Schubert Day.
